Showcasing a sun, which provides the warm temperatures to ripen our grapes, this is the perfect drink for warm weather. The cactus reminds us that our grapes are grown on the driest state, on the driest continent on earth and this Provence styled rosé is 'dry as a bone'. A blend of 64% Mataro & 36% Grenache. The Grenache component was grown here on our own vineyards using organic and biodynamic practices while the Mataro comes from older vine material in Greenock. Each variety was picked and made separately. Our soils are quite shallow and have outcrops of ironstone in the vineyard, which gives the wine a nice savoury edge. Very pale pastel pink, almost brassy in colour, with aromas of red apple, fresh raspberries, cherries and strawberry yogurt. The palate is dry, but has great fruit weight and great length. There is some complexity on the palate from the lees stirring. The perfect drink for a sunny day!

Barossa Valley Wine

The Barossa Valley wine region has historically and currently still is one of Australia's most prestigious premium wine producing regions. Located just 60km north east of Adelaide city centre, the climate there is very hot and dry which is perfect for the big bold reds the area is famous for.
A straight Shiraz is what Barossa is most well known for, however Rhone blends, such as Shiraz Cabernet are also very popular. While much less prevalent, white wines (Chardonnay, Riesling, Semillon) are planted on the higher altitude hillsides where the ocean breeze cools temperatures down to a level suitable for producing these varieties as well.
Some of Australia's earliest Shiraz plantings can be found here dating as far back as the 1850's. While not always a guarantee of quality, it might be worth seeking out and trying one of the region's "old vine shiraz" if you haven't yet.
